A cannabis magnesium deficiency starves leaves of the chlorophyll they need to turn light into energy. Left unchecked, it stunts growth, kills off lower leaves and shrinks your final harvest. It hits hardest during flowering, leaving you with airy, underweight buds. The good news is that a mag deficiency ranks among the most fixable problems you'll come across.
Catch it early and a simple correction turns things around within days. This guide walks you through the symptoms, lookalikes, causes and ways to prevent a repeat.
TL;DR: A magnesium deficiency looks like pale yellowing between the veins on your lower, older leaves while the veins stay green. It often turns up in hydro and soilless grows fed with RO or soft water. Check your root-zone pH first, then feed your plants magnesium with Epsom salt or Cal-Mag. New growth should recover within 3-5 days, though damaged leaves won't turn green again.
What Does Magnesium Do for Cannabis Plants?
Magnesium (Mg) fuels chlorophyll production in cannabis plants and drives the enzyme reactions behind healthy growth. Chlorophyll is the green pigment that captures light and powers photosynthesis.
Magnesium also helps move other nutrients around the plant and build the proteins that form new cells. It sits among the secondary macronutrients, alongside calcium and sulfur, so your plants need it in real quantities.
Starve a plant of magnesium and photosynthesis grinds down, since it can't make enough chlorophyll to feed itself. Growth slows to a crawl while older leaves yellow, die and drop. A shortage during flowering is especially costly, since the plant needs magnesium most as buds form. Severe cases stunt the plant for good, so ignoring it costs you real yield.
What Are the Signs of a Cannabis Magnesium Deficiency?
A magnesium deficiency shows up first on the lower, older leaves because the weed plant moves Mg to new growth. It’s a mobile nutrient, so your plant strips its old leaves to feed fresh shoots. That's why the damage starts at the bottom and climbs up the canopy if you leave it. Here's how it looks and how it progresses:

Early, Progressing and Advanced Signs

Side-by-side cannabis leaves showing how magnesium deficiency develops, from early yellowing between the veins to severe discoloration and leaf damage.
A magnesium deficiency follows a clear path, so knowing the stage helps you judge how urgently to act. Watch for this progression:
- Early: faint yellowing between the veins on the lowest, oldest leaves.
- Progressing: the yellowing climbs upward, leaf edges crisp up and stems may redden.
- Advanced: leaves brown, curl and die while new shoots fade toward white.
Interveinal Chlorosis: Yellowing Between the Veins

A close-up look at magnesium deficiency, with yellowing between the veins while the veins stay noticeably green.
Interveinal chlorosis turns the leaf tissue between the veins pale yellow while the veins themselves stay green. This green-vein, yellow-tissue pattern is the clearest single sign of a magnesium problem. It's the opposite of what the name might suggest, so remember the veins keep their color. Small rust-colored spots sometimes appear in the yellow patches as the shortage deepens.
Red or Purple Stems and Petioles
Red or purple stems and petioles often accompany a magnesium deficiency, though some cultivars show that color naturally. Petioles are the small stalks that join each leaf to the branch. On their own, reddish purple stems aren't proof, so treat them as a supporting clue. Make sure you see interveinal yellowing too before you reach for a supplement.
Crispy Edges, Curling and Dying Leaves
Crispy leaf edges, upward curling and leaf death are all signs of an advanced magnesium deficiency. The edges turn dry and brittle, and the leaves may curl or "taco" upward. That crispiness sits at the leaf margins, a texture you can feel. Left longer, whole leaves yellow, brown and drop from the plant.
How Does an Mg Deficiency Compare to Other Deficiencies?
A mag deficiency looks a lot like several other cannabis problems, so a wrong guess sends you down the wrong fix. Dosing magnesium when the real issue is iron or pH wastes time and builds up salts. The fastest tell is symptom-to-leaf position, since magnesium hits old, lower leaves while many lookalikes strike new growth. Here's how to tell them apart:

Common Look-Alikes That Mimic Magnesium Deficiency
Several cannabis deficiencies mimic magnesium, but each one has a tell that sets it apart. Symptom position and the exact pattern usually give it away. This table covers the problems most often mistaken for a magnesium shortage:
| Problem | Where it appears | How it differs from magnesium deficiency |
| Potassium Deficiency | Lower, older leaves | Leaf edges brown and burn first, with rusty red and yellow spotting between them |
| Iron Deficiency | New top growth | Same interveinal yellowing, but on young leaves not old |
| Calcium Deficiency | New growth | Brown spots and hooked, curling new leaves |
| Zinc Deficiency | New growth | Twisted new leaves with short gaps between nodes |
| Manganese Deficiency | New growth | Interveinal yellowing, but with small, brown dead specks in the yellow tissue |
| Sulfur Deficiency | Whole new leaves | Even yellowing across young leaves, veins included |
| Nutrient Burn | Leaf tips and margins | Burnt leaf tips from overfeeding, no interveinal yellowing |
| Natural Genetics | Stems and petioles | Red or purple coloring with no leaf yellowing |
The fastest sort is leaf position. A magnesium deficiency starts at the older, lower leaves, so anything hitting the fresh top growth is a different problem altogether. If you find a symptom on the older leaves, read the pattern first. When two causes still seem to fit, check your pH and water before you feed anything, since a lockout can wear almost any deficiency's face.
Is a Cal-Mag Deficiency the Same as a Magnesium Deficiency?
No. A "Cal-Mag deficiency" means calcium and magnesium are both running low at once. A magnesium deficiency is just one half of that. The two often show up together because the same grow conditions starve both nutrients at once: poor-quality water, an unbuffered coco or hydro medium or no cal-mag supplementation in the feeding schedule. A Cal-Mag product treats both deficiencies.
When Nutrient Excesses Cause Magnesium Issues and Other Problems
Nutrient excesses tip the balance in more than one direction, and each one is worth knowing.
- Excess potassium is a main driver behind a magnesium deficiency. High potassium levels crowd magnesium out at the root zone, so the plant runs short even when there's plenty of magnesium in the mix. The two nutrients compete for uptake in both directions, so heavy magnesium feeding can just as easily crowd out potassium.
- Excess magnesium can cause a potassium or calcium deficiency. It's the same root-level competition, this time with magnesium as the one crowding the others out.
- Outright magnesium toxicity is rarer. The plant can store surplus magnesium inside its cells, so it takes a lot to reach harmful levels. That said, heavy overfeeding will still eventually burn the leaf tips and yellow the older leaves.
Potassium and magnesium keep each other in check at the roots, so an excess of either one can crowd out the other. Very high ammonium-nitrogen feeding can crowd magnesium out too. Either way, proper nutrient balance beats piling on any single nutrient.
What Causes a Magnesium Deficiency in Cannabis Plants?
A cannabis magnesium deficiency usually comes down to a handful of grow-environment causes. It's common in hydro and soilless mixes and rare in healthy outdoor soil. These are the usual culprits:
- Mineral-poor water: RO (reverse osmosis), distilled and soft tap water carry little to no magnesium.
- Low or acidic pH: a root zone below the ideal range can reduce magnesium availability, even when it's present in the feed.
- Cation imbalance: heavy potassium feeding crowds magnesium out at the roots, even when magnesium levels in the feed are fine.
- Magnesium-poor medium: coco and some soilless mixes start with very little magnesium.
- Overwatering or poor drainage: soggy roots can't absorb magnesium properly.
- Heavy leaching: frequent heavy watering or rain flushes magnesium out of the medium.
If your water already has a moderate mineral content (around 125 ppm on a TDS meter), it usually supplies enough magnesium on its own. The risk sits with near-zero sources like RO and distilled water.
How Do You Fix a Cannabis Magnesium Deficiency?
Fixing a cannabis magnesium deficiency works best as a set order, so tackle these four steps in sequence. Rushing to dose magnesium before checking pH is the most common mistake, so start at the top. Give your plants a few days to respond before you judge the result.
Here's the sequence:
- Step 1: Test your pH. Find out whether lockout is the real problem.
- Step 2: Correct pH and flush if needed. Clear the path for uptake.
- Step 3: Feed magnesium. Dose Epsom salt, Cal-Mag or dolomite lime by medium.
- Step 4: Watch new growth. Confirm recovery and ease back off.
Step 1: Test Your pH
Testing your pH tells you whether magnesium is missing or just locked out. Use a pH pen on your soil runoff or your hydro reservoir. In soil, keep the root zone at 6.0-6.3, and treat 6.5 as the hard ceiling.
Climb past that and you start locking out iron, manganese and zinc, the very micronutrients whose deficiencies mimic a magnesium problem. In hydro or coco, hold pH at 5.8-6.2, with 5.6-6.4 as the workable range.
Step 2: Correct pH and Flush if Needed
Correcting pH reopens magnesium uptake, so adjust it before you add any supplements. In hydro or coco, mix your feed and bring that solution into range with pH Up or pH Down. Soil depends on your program. If you run synthetic nutrients, pH the mixed feed the same way.
But living, organic soil holds its own pH through the microbes at the roots, so you leave the water alone there. If it has genuinely drifted, correct the soil itself with slow amendments:
- Dolomite lime to bring up a too-acidic root zone (which also adds magnesium).
- Elemental sulfur and acidic materials like coffee grounds to pull a high pH down.
Since an acidic root zone is one of the most common causes of a magnesium lockout, raising it with dolomite often fixes the pH and the shortage together.
Flushing is a separate job from correcting pH. If salts have built up from heavy feeding, run clean, pH-balanced water (no nutrients added) through the medium until about 30% drains out. This clears the buildup and resets your starting point. Sort the pH on that fresh baseline, then move on to feeding.
Step 3: Feed Magnesium With Epsom Salt, Cal-Mag or Dolomite Lime
Once pH is in range, feed the magnesium directly. Which product you pick depends on your water and what else is running short:
Epsom salt (magnesium sulfate) is the quick, cheap fix for a straight magnesium shortage. It dissolves cleanly into water, soil or a foliar spray, and foliar feeding acts fastest since leaves take up magnesium quicker than roots. Use the doses below, then drop to a lighter maintenance feed once the plant recovers.
| Application Application | Epsom salt dose |
| Hydro reservoir or planting mix |
1 teaspoon per gallon (or about ¼ teaspoon per liter) |
| Mixed into soil directly |
1 teaspoon per quart of soil (or about 1 teaspoon per liter) |
| Foliar spray (fastest acting) |
1 teaspoon per gallon (or about ¼ teaspoon per liter) |
| Maintenance after correction | A quarter dose with each watering or reservoir change |
A Cal-Mag supplement supplies magnesium alongside calcium and usually a little iron, which makes it the better pick for RO and soft-water grows. Because a calcium shortfall often shows up next to the magnesium one, Cal-Mag covers both at once. Mix it at the label rate in your reservoir or watering can, or spray it on the leaves.
Dolomite lime and slow-release options suit soil growers who want steady magnesium without regular dosing. Dolomite feeds magnesium slowly and nudges an acidic soil pH upward over several months, so mix a fine grade into your soil before planting and water it in to settle. Worm castings work as a gentler, longer-term source alongside it.
Step 4: Watch New Growth and Ease Off
Watching your new growth confirms whether the fix worked. Fresh leaves should come in green within 3-5 days, and the yellowing should stop spreading. Damaged leaves won't turn green again, so judge success by new growth, not old. Once the plant recovers, drop to a lighter maintenance dose to avoid overloading magnesium.
How Do You Prevent a Magnesium Deficiency in Cannabis?
Preventing a cannabis magnesium deficiency comes down to steady pH, the right water and balanced feeding.

- Test your pH regularly, since even plenty of magnesium won't help if the root zone drifts acidic.
- Feed on a consistent schedule and resist the urge to overfeed any single nutrient.
- Avoid overwatering, which stresses roots and slows how well they take up magnesium.
- Add Cal-Mag from the start rather than waiting for symptoms, especially if you grow with RO or distilled water. Soil growers can mix dolomite lime in before planting for a steady, slow-release supply.
Prevention takes far less effort than nursing a damaged plant back to health.
